Intel Vs Amd

Intel and AMD are the two giants in the processor market. Each has its strengths and weaknesses. Intel processors are known for their strong single-core performance, which is great for gaming. The Intel Core i7 and i9 series are popular among gamers and streamers for their high performance.

On the other hand, AMD processors have made significant strides with their Ryzen series. The Ryzen 7 and 9 series offer impressive multi-core performance, which is beneficial for streaming and multitasking. AMD also tends to be more budget-friendly, giving you excellent value for money.

So, which should you choose? It depends on your priorities. If you want top-notch gaming performance, Intel might be your go-to. If you’re looking for a balance between gaming and streaming, AMD offers strong contenders.

Best Storage Options: Ssd Vs Hdd

Storage is where your data lives. The two main types are SSD (Solid State Drive) and HDD (Hard Disk Drive). SSDs are faster and more reliable than HDDs.

An SSD can significantly reduce game load times. Imagine diving into your favorite game in seconds rather than minutes. Streaming also benefits from faster read/write speeds, reducing delays and buffering.

HDDs offer more storage space at a lower cost. They are ideal for storing large files like game libraries, videos, and backups. However, they are slower and less durable than SSDs.

For the best of both worlds, consider a laptop with both SSD and HDD. Use the SSD for your operating system and frequently played games. Store everything else on the HDD.

Refresh Rate Importance

The refresh rate affects how smooth your game looks. A higher refresh rate means smoother gameplay. This can make a big difference. Most gamers prefer at least a 120Hz refresh rate. It reduces motion blur and screen tearing. This is essential for fast-paced games. A 60Hz refresh rate may not be enough for competitive gaming.

Resolution Choices For Gamers

Resolution impacts how clear and detailed your game appears. The most common resolutions are 1080p, 1440p, and 4K. 1080p is good for most games. It’s also easier on your laptop’s hardware. 1440p offers better clarity and detail. It’s a good middle ground. 4K provides the best visuals but demands more from your laptop. Choose the resolution that balances performance and quality for your needs.

Top Cooling Technologies

Several technologies help keep gaming laptops cool. One popular method is liquid cooling. This system uses liquid to transfer heat. It is more effective than air cooling. Another common technology is vapor chamber cooling. It uses a vacuum-sealed chamber. This chamber spreads heat evenly. It is often used in high-end gaming laptops. Heat pipes are also widely used. They transfer heat from the CPU and GPU. Fans then blow this heat out of the laptop. More fans usually mean better cooling. Finally, some laptops use advanced software. This software manages the cooling system. It adjusts fan speed and performance. It balances cooling and noise levels. Choosing a laptop with good cooling technology is crucial. Best External Microphones

Even if your laptop has a good built-in microphone, an external microphone can significantly improve your streaming quality. One highly recommended option is the Blue Yeti. It’s known for its clear audio and ease of use.

Another excellent choice is the HyperX QuadCast. It comes with a built-in anti-vibration shock mount, which is great for reducing noise from keyboard and mouse clicks. Plus, it has multiple polar patterns to suit different recording situations.

You might also consider the Audio-Technica AT2020. This microphone offers professional-quality sound and is relatively affordable. It’s a popular choice among streamers who want to step up their audio game without breaking the bank.
